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Aged 18 to 70 years; 2. Clear history of head trauma and traumatic intracranial lesions (acute epidural hematoma, acute subdural hematoma, brain contusion, intracerebral hematoma, diffuse axonal injury, brain stem injury, etc.) confirmed by head CT; 3. The patient was admitted to the hospital or emergency department within 12 hours after the onset of the disease, and the head CT was completed within 1 hour to confirm the presence of traumatic intracranial lesions; 4. The fibrinogen level was less than 2.0 L/h after admission.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Patients with GCS score of 3 and bilateral fixed pupil; 2. Patients with previous brain diseases with neurological deficits or disturbance of consciousness; 3. Patients with life expectancy less than 3 days after onset of disease; 4. Pregnancy, childbirth or lactation within 30 days; 5. The patient had severe liver dysfunction before the onset of the disease; 6. The patients had decreased fibrinogen level or dysfunction before the onset of the disease; 7. The patient had congenital or acquired thrombocytopenia before onset; 8. The patients only with scalp hematoma and skull fracture confirmed by head CT; 9. The patient had no history of long-term or recent anticoagulant and antiplatelet drugs before onset.
